Ford F150 battery drain when towing Travel Trailer

Hello,

I recently purchased a 2019 F150 to pull our travel trailer (it has the trailer package). When I pull the trailer long distances (3 hours+ driving) I'm finding that my F150 struggles to start when whenever I shut off the vehicle (such as in gas stations etc).

Recently, I did a 5 hour drive, and 30 mins from home I stopped for gas and the vehicle wouldn't start back up again and had to get AAA to jump me. It seems to me that the battery is getting drained by the trailer.

I've had the battery, starter and alternator on the F150 checked by 2 different people and each time they have passed with no issues.

I do have a rear view camera plugged into the 12v charger within the cab, and sometimes the kids or my wife or I will charge their phone in the cab as well.

If I unplug the trailer and unplug the rear view camera, I have found that the vehicle has a better chance of starting.

I had an older F150 (2004) previously which had no issues like this, we would charge items in the cab and use the rear view camera etc and it would start fine.

I'm trying to figure out where the source of the problem may lie, any ideas? Could the battery on the trailer be an issue? Could the wiring harness on the F150 be at fault? Is there an issue with newer F150s being able to handle charging devices as well as the trailer?

Any thoughts would be greatly appreciated!

  • X2 for a DC clamp on ammeter and voltmeter. Check the battery voltage at high idle with the trailer attached. Check the amp draw on the trailer wire. Load test the truck and trailer batteries.

    Maintaining the truck battery should be a non issue for the alternator. If the trailer draws to many amps the truck fuse to the trailer should blow, check to see what size is currently installed.

    Did your "people testers" apply a significant load to the truck battery to confirm that it's being charged at the maximum? Unless you know for absolute certain that the truck battery and alternator are good...
  • So have you been on a three hour drive without the trailer and no issues?

    I would be leaving the truck running and check the truck battery voltage. Check direct on the battery terminals and check on the connectors. s/b the same and more than 13.2 volts. Post the results.

    Then shut down the truck and check again. When it fails again check voltage while cranking. Post all results.

    I recommend to carry a jump box while this issue persists.

    I really doubt it is the trailer.

  • Rivolva wrote:
    I'm trying to figure out where the source of the problem may lie, any ideas? Could the battery on the trailer be an issue? Could the wiring harness on the F150 be at fault? Is there an issue with newer F150s being able to handle charging devices as well as the trailer?

    It could be a dozen different thing. Stop making wild guess and buy a current clamp !

    With no trailer attached, start the engine and place the meter on either the positive or negative battery lead. (It may take 5+ minutes for the reading to stabilize, so be patient !)

    Record the reading. Remove the meter, shut the engine off and connect the trailer. Start the engine and place the meter on the same wire. After waiting for things to stabilize, you should be getting almost the same meter.

    Get out your owners manual and find the page that lists the fuses. Remove any fuse that is associated with the trailer, one at a time, checking the meter each time for a change.
